1842 in Denmark

Events from the year 1842 in Denmark.
Incumbents
- Monarch – Christian VIII
- Prime minister – Otto Joachim, Poul Christian Stemann
Events
- 23 July – the Hørsholm Textile Factory is established in Hørsholm.
Undated
- The National Liberal Party is formed.
- Jørgen Ernst Meyer establishes the nation's first lacquerware company.
Births
January{{ndash}}March
- 25 January Vilhelm Thomsen, linguist (died 1927)
- 4 February – Georg Brandes, critic and scholar (died 1927)
- 27 February Theodor Wessel, businessman (died 1905)
- 2 March – Carl Jacobsen, brewer, industrialist and arts patron (died 1914)
- 9 March Vilhelm Groth, painter (died 1899)
April{{ndash}}June
- 3 April Niels Peter Bornholdt, businessman (died 1924)
- 6 May Emil Christian Hansen, chemist (died 1909)
- 16 May Gustav Adolph Hagemann, engineer and businessman (died 1916)
July{{ndash}}September
- 9 July Emil Poulsen, actor (died 1911)
- 17 August – Hugo Egmont Hørring, politician, prime minister of Denmark (died 1909)
- 22 August Emilie Mundt, painter (died 1922)
